Irish woman shot in Lanzarote

It would have been hard to pick up a paper recently without hearing about Michelle Massey being shot by her partner, Eulogio (Lolo) Ramonbernal in Lanzarote.

Lolo shot Michelle repeatedly, in front of their 6 month old son, Ruben. Having lost a kidney, and recovering slowly in Negrin Hospital, Gran Canaria… Michelle has been on the minds of many expats in Lanzarote.

Michelle originally moved to Lanzarote in 2006, and started working at McSorley’s Bar in Puerto Calero. Tom and Suzi Mooney, the owners of McSorley’s, described Michelle as “such a lovely girl”.

If you would like to help raise some money for Michelle… then a benefit night is being held at The Rare Auld Times bar in the Old Town, Puerto del Carmen on June 22nd.

Our thoughts remain with Michelle and her family, and we wish her a speedy recovery.
